Understanding Cat5e: The Reliable Standard
Cat5e (Category 5 enhanced) has been the go-to standard for Ethernet cabling for many years, and for good reason. It was designed to significantly reduce “crosstalk”—unwanted signal interference between wire pairs—compared to its predecessor, the now-obsolete Cat5.
- Speed: Supports speeds up to 1 Gigabit per second (Gbps).
- Bandwidth: Operates at a frequency of 100 MHz.
- Best For: Standard home internet, small office networks, and applications that do not require data transfer speeds beyond 1 Gbps.
For most everyday residential and light commercial use, Cat5e provides more than enough performance for streaming HD video, online gaming, and general web browsing.
Understanding Cat6: The Performance Upgrade
Cat6 (Category 6) represents a significant step up in performance. It was engineered to handle higher speeds and provides a more robust and future-proof solution for modern networking demands. This is achieved through stricter manufacturing standards, tighter-twisted wire pairs, and often a physical separator.
- Speed: Supports 1 Gbps up to 100 meters, and can achieve 10 Gbps over shorter distances (up to 55 meters).
- Bandwidth: Operates at a much higher frequency of 250 MHz, allowing more data to be transmitted simultaneously.
- Best For: Business networks, data centers, smart homes with numerous connected devices, and users who want to future-proof their network infrastructure.
The key physical difference in many Cat6 cables is the inclusion of a “spline,” a plastic cross-divider that isolates the four twisted pairs of wires, drastically reducing crosstalk and enabling higher performance.
Head-to-Head Comparison: Cat6 vs. Cat5e
Let’s break down the core differences in a direct comparison to make the choice clearer.
Performance & Speed
This is the most significant difference. While both Cat5e and Cat6 can handle Gigabit speeds (1 Gbps), only Cat6 is rated for 10 Gbps speeds. Although this higher speed is limited to shorter cable runs (under 55 meters or 180 feet), it makes Cat6 the superior choice for high-demand networks and for ensuring your infrastructure is ready for future internet speed advancements.
Bandwidth & Frequency
Think of bandwidth (measured in MHz) as the width of a highway. Cat5e has a 100 MHz highway, while Cat6 has a 250 MHz highway. The wider path of Cat6 allows more data to travel at the same time, reducing potential bottlenecks and improving overall network efficiency, especially in environments with heavy traffic from multiple devices.
Crosstalk & Interference
Crosstalk occurs when the signal from one wire bleeds into an adjacent wire, corrupting the data. Due to its tighter wire twists and the common inclusion of a spline, Cat6 offers far superior protection against crosstalk (both near-end crosstalk and alien crosstalk) than Cat5e. This results in a more stable, reliable signal with fewer data errors, which is critical for business-critical applications, high-quality streaming, and competitive online gaming.
Cost
Given its advanced construction and higher performance capabilities, Cat6 cable is generally more expensive than Cat5e. However, the price difference has narrowed significantly over time. When considering a new installation, the modest additional cost for Cat6 is often a worthwhile investment in network longevity and performance.
Which Cable Should You Choose? Practical Scenarios
Your choice ultimately depends on your specific needs and budget.
- For Standard Home Use: If you’re simply connecting your computer to a router for browsing and streaming on a standard internet plan (under 1 Gbps), Cat5e is perfectly adequate.
- For Future-Proofing & Power Users: If you are a gamer, a content creator, run a media server, or simply want to ensure your home network can handle faster internet speeds in the future, Cat6 is the recommended choice. The small extra cost provides significant performance headroom.
- For Business & Office Environments: For any new commercial installation, Cat6 should be the minimum standard. The demands of multiple users, VoIP phones, data transfers, and server connections make the superior performance and reliability of Cat6 essential for productivity.

Conclusion: Making the Right Connection
To summarize, the primary differences between Cat6 and Cat5e lie in speed, bandwidth, and crosstalk resistance.
Cat5e is the reliable workhorse, capable of Gigabit speeds and perfect for many standard applications. Cat6 is the high-performance upgrade, offering a wider data highway, the potential for 10 Gbps speeds, and superior signal integrity, making it the ideal choice for new installations and demanding environments.
